数据库和仓库在数据管理和分析中各有优势与劣势。数据库适用于日常交易处理,速度快,但难以处理大量历史数据。数据仓库则擅长处理大量历史数据,支持复杂查询,但建立和维护成本高。两者结合能最大化数据利用价值。
本文目录导读:
随着信息技术的飞速发展,数据已经成为企业核心竞争力的重要组成部分,为了更好地管理和利用数据,数据库和数据仓库成为了企业信息管理的重要工具,本文将从数据库和数据仓库的优势与劣势两方面进行详细解析,以帮助企业更好地选择适合自己的数据管理方案。
数据库的优势
1、数据管理:数据库能够对数据进行高效、准确的管理,确保数据的完整性和一致性,通过建立数据模型,数据库能够对数据进行分类、组织,方便用户查询和分析。
2、数据安全性:数据库提供了强大的数据安全性保障,包括用户权限管理、数据加密、备份与恢复等功能,有效防止数据泄露和损坏。
图片来源于网络,如有侵权联系删除
3、高效查询:数据库采用索引、缓存等技术,能够实现高效的数据查询,通过优化查询语句,用户可以快速获取所需信息。
4、事务处理:数据库支持事务处理,确保数据的一致性和完整性,在事务执行过程中,数据库会自动进行锁定、提交或回滚,确保数据的安全性。
5、可扩展性:数据库具有良好的可扩展性,可以根据企业需求进行升级和扩展,通过增加存储空间、优化性能等方式,满足不断增长的数据需求。
数据库的劣势
1、复杂性:数据库的安装、配置和管理较为复杂,需要专业的技术人才进行维护。
2、成本:数据库软件和硬件设备的成本较高,对于中小企业来说可能是一个负担。
3、性能瓶颈:随着数据量的增加,数据库的性能可能会出现瓶颈,导致查询速度变慢。
4、数据冗余:在数据库中,数据可能存在冗余,导致存储空间浪费。
数据仓库的优势
1、数据集成:数据仓库能够将来自不同源的数据进行集成,实现数据的统一管理和分析。
图片来源于网络,如有侵权联系删除
2、数据分析:数据仓库提供强大的数据分析功能,帮助企业挖掘数据价值,为决策提供支持。
3、事务性支持:数据仓库支持历史数据的查询和分析,有助于企业了解业务发展轨迹。
4、优化性能:数据仓库采用数据分区、索引等技术,提高查询性能。
5、成本效益:与数据库相比,数据仓库在存储和管理大量数据方面具有更高的成本效益。
数据仓库的劣势
1、复杂性:数据仓库的构建和维护较为复杂,需要专业的技术团队进行支持。
2、成本:数据仓库的构建和维护成本较高,对于中小企业来说可能难以承受。
3、数据更新:数据仓库中的数据需要定期更新,以保证数据的准确性和时效性。
4、性能瓶颈:随着数据量的增加,数据仓库的性能可能会出现瓶颈,导致查询速度变慢。
图片来源于网络,如有侵权联系删除
数据库和数据仓库各有优势与劣势,企业在选择适合自己的数据管理方案时,需要综合考虑自身业务需求、技术实力和成本等因素,在实际应用中,企业可以根据以下建议进行选择:
1、对于数据管理、查询和安全性要求较高的企业,建议采用数据库。
2、对于需要数据集成、分析和历史数据查询的企业,建议采用数据仓库。
3、对于中小型企业,在预算有限的情况下,可以考虑采用云数据库或云数据仓库,以降低成本。
数据库和数据仓库在企业信息管理中扮演着重要角色,企业应根据自身需求,选择合适的数据管理方案,以提高数据利用效率和决策水平。
标签: #数据库优势分析 #数据库与数据仓库对比
评论列表